About BSC
 
The Barcelona Supercomputing Center - Centro Nacional de Supercomputación (BSC-CNS) is the leading supercomputing center in Spain. It houses MareNostrum, one of the most powerful supercomputers in Europe, was a founding and hosting member of the former European HPC infrastructure PRACE (Partnership for Advanced Computing in Europe), and is now hosting entity for EuroHPC JU, the Joint Undertaking that leads large-scale investments and HPC provision in Europe. The mission of BSC is to research, develop and manage information technologies in order to facilitate scientific progress. BSC combines HPC service provision and R&D into both computer and computational science (life, earth and engineering sciences) under one roof, and currently has over 1000 staff from 60 countries.

Context And Mission
 
Within the Earth Sciences Department of Barcelona Supercomputing Center (BSC), led by Prof Francisco Doblas-Reyes, the Computational Earth Sciences group is looking for a Python and Web developer to join the Data and Diagnostic Team and contribute to the development and maintenance of front-end (interactive dashboards, etc ...) and back-end (epidemiological models, etc ...) applications for climate and health services in collaboration with the Global Health Resilience group, led by ICREA Professor Rachel Lowe.The mission of the GHR group is to apply a transdisciplinary approach to co-designing policy-relevant methodological solutions, to enhance surveillance, preparedness and response to climate-sensitive disease outbreaks and emergence.
Mentioned applications (front-end and back-end) will be developed both in Python and R. The whole pipeline also includes a back-end part of data collection (download and formatting) and processing, using tools developed in-house. All tools will be working within an High Performance Computing environment.

We need a proactive candidate with good programming skills to join our development team, contribute to maintenance and user support of current services and improve both back-end and front-end of the applications for future releases.
